Animation of the flow of blood through a blood vessel.

Pre-K - Higher Ed
Shown are red blood cells (erythrocytes, red), which transport oxygen, white blood cells (leucocytes, white), part of the immune system, and platelets (thrombocytes, yellow), which are active in blood coagulation (clotting)
